Output 42412fa89ab7c7e66a7131795c514e54bcb433473c928cee0fba6241ead5360f:1

value
2912308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b0fb997135d2151bd6a4b7feadb77524237e350 OP_EQUAL
address
3QaWNHM9RnfjXRhghLy5teD73xjBPLbwr2
transaction
42412fa89ab7c7e66a7131795c514e54bcb433473c928cee0fba6241ead5360f
confirmations
351273
spent
true